Output 76594dda2a90f42ba1ea12ad84b79b6e634b2d1d1df10497e085fe91a624aff5:0

value
2693000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53ab22e2c16636f8bbe0716be46917adfbda4cf OP_EQUAL
address
3KfsMc3qFJQi8nLnHwto9kaxPbB9zdyz5N
transaction
76594dda2a90f42ba1ea12ad84b79b6e634b2d1d1df10497e085fe91a624aff5
spent
true